SUBJ: IPS DAILY HF PROPAGATION REPORT
ISSUED AT 10/2330Z JANUARY 2008 BY IPS RADIO AND SPACE SERVICES
FROM THE AUSTRALIAN SPACE FORECAST CENTRE
AUSTRALIAN REGION SUMMARY AND FORECAST

1. SUMMARY (10 JANUARY) 
Date   T index  Conditions    
10 Jan    -7    Normal-fair    

Flares: None

MUFs:
   Equatorial PNG/Niue Region:
      Near predicted monthly values. Depressions to 30% at
      Vanimo 10-20 UT.
   Northern Australian Region:
      Near predicted monthly values. Depressions to 30%
      11-20 UT. Some sporadic E observed.
   Southern Australian and New Zealand Region:
      Near predicted monthly values. Depressions to 25% 10-18
      UT. Sporadic E observed with blanketing of the F region
      much of the time at Canberra and Sydney.
   Antarctic Region (Casey/Scott Base/Davis/Mawson):
      Near predicted monthly values. Depressions to 30% at
      Macquarie Is. 12-16 UT.

PCA Event : No event.

Predicted Monthly T index for January:  12

2. FORECAST (11 JANUARY - 13 JANUARY)
Date   T index  Conditions       MUFs                              
11 Jan     0    Normal           Near predicted monthly values 
                                 to 30% depressed. 
12 Jan     0    Normal           Near predicted monthly values 
                                 to 30% depressed.     
13 Jan     0    Normal           Near predicted monthly values 
                                 to 30% depressed.    

COMMENT: Longer distance HF sky wave communications may be affected 
at times due to sporadic E formation.
